From 86f9d9da58c71222838494d92d174d5614c83280 Mon Sep 17 00:00:00 2001 From: Gaute Hope Date: Tue, 29 Oct 2024 10:18:39 +0100 Subject: [PATCH] web.post: update blues-notecard --- sfy-buoy/Cargo.lock | 21 ++++++++++++++++----- sfy-buoy/Cargo.toml | 2 +- 2 files changed, 17 insertions(+), 6 deletions(-) diff --git a/sfy-buoy/Cargo.lock b/sfy-buoy/Cargo.lock index 2230146..6817200 100644 --- a/sfy-buoy/Cargo.lock +++ b/sfy-buoy/Cargo.lock @@ -230,14 +230,14 @@ checksum = "b048fb63fd8b5923fc5aa7b340d8e156aec7ec02f0c78fa8a6ddc2613f6f71de" [[package]] name = "blues-notecard" -version = "0.3.2" -source = "git+https://github.com/gauteh/notecard-rs#ab8fa27a639e5ca7241d9b38350d8023e7c641d9" +version = "0.4.0" +source = "git+https://github.com/gauteh/notecard-rs#c47d7095c8c85a89a3583638c58f780a7c26f5fb" dependencies = [ "defmt", "embedded-hal", "heapless", "serde", - "serde-json-core", + "serde-json-core 0.5.1", ] [[package]] @@ -1173,6 +1173,17 @@ dependencies = [ "serde", ] +[[package]] +name = "serde-json-core" +version = "0.5.1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"3c9e1ab533c0bc414c34920ec7e5f097101d126ed5eac1a1aac711222e0bbb33" +dependencies = [ + "heapless", + "ryu", + "serde", +] + [[package]] name = "serde_derive" version = "1.0.210" @@ -1220,7 +1231,7 @@ dependencies = [ "postcard", "rtcc", "serde", - "serde-json-core", + "serde-json-core 0.5.1", "serde_json", "static_assertions", ] @@ -1354,7 +1365,7 @@ dependencies = [ "micromath", "panic-probe", "serde", - "serde-json-core", + "serde-json-core 0.4.0", "sfy", ] diff --git a/sfy-buoy/Cargo.toml b/sfy-buoy/Cargo.toml index 90d5326..d910c3c 100644 --- a/sfy-buoy/Cargo.toml +++ b/sfy-buoy/Cargo.toml @@ -20,7 +20,7 @@ heapless = { version = "0.7", features = [ "serde", "ufmt-impl", "defmt-impl" ] embedded-sdmmc = { version = "0.6.0", default-features = false, features = ["defmt-log"] } postcard = { version = "1.0.1", features = [ "experimental-derive" ]} serde = { version = "1", features = ["derive"], default-features = false } -serde-json-core = { version = "0.4", optional = true } +serde-json-core = { version = "0.5.1", optional = true } serde_json = { version = "1", optional = true } embedded-hal = "0.2.6" cortex-m = "*"